GOLF PIONEERS
In 1979, after realizing that the new two-piece golf balls flew farther and straighter when hit by a metal-headed club rather than a wood-head, Gary Adams decided to break from traditional and create TaylorMade. Adams hired two employees and in their first year they managed to fill close to $50,000 worth of orders.Over the years, Adams continued to revolutionize the technology and focused on matching clubs to golfers. The 300 Series provided three different drivers to match golf’s three main swing types. TaylorMade drivers rank as the best-selling drivers worldwide and the most popular drivers on the PGA Tour.
